Abstract. It is shown that a class of composition operators $C_\phi $ has the property that for every $\lambda $ in the interior of the spectrum of $C_\phi $ the operator $U=C_\phi -\lambda{\rm Id}$ is universal in the sense of Caradus, i.e., every Hilbert space operator has a non-zero multiple similar to the restriction of $U$ to an invariant subspace. As a generalization, weighted composition operators on the $L^2$ and Sobolev spaces of the unit interval are shown to have the same property and thus a complete knowledge of their minimal invariant subspaces would imply a solution to the invariant subspace problem for Hilbert space. Moreover, a generalization of sufficient conditions for an operator to be universal is obtained. Cyclicity and non-cyclicity results for a certain class of weights and composition functions are also proved.
